Fees & Payments
- All prices and fees are listed in U.S. Dollars.
- Prices are updated every calendar year. Prices and dates are subject to change without notice and will be confirmed upon invoicing. For current prices, please refer to the BridgeAbroad website at http://studyabroad.bridge.edu.
- A non-refundable $95 application fee (or $125 application fee for all internship programs) is required with the completed application. This fee cannot be applied to the program fee and will only be refunded if BridgeAbroad cancels the program (excluding instances of Force Majeure).
- A non-refundable $95 rush fee will be applied to any participant who submits an application after the stated application deadlines.
- Within one week of acceptance into the BridgeAbroad program, participants must submit a non-refundable confirmation deposit of $500 to verify their participation on the program. This deposit, which is applied to the overall program fee, will not be refundable for any reason, unless BridgeAbroad cancels the program prior to commencement of the program (excluding instances of Force Majeure).If the program acceptance is issued within sixty (60) days prior to the scheduled program arrival date, the applicant will be responsible for paying a deposit of $500 in addition to fifty (50) percent of the remaining program balance.
- Fifty (50) percent of the remaining program balance will be due sixty (60) days prior to the scheduled program arrival date. If this payment is not received by the deadline, BridgeAbroad will consider your application withdrawn, your enrollment will be cancelled, and all cancellation policies will apply. The remainder of the program fee will be due in full thirty (30) days prior to the program arrival date. BridgeAbroad will not be able to confirm course enrollment, housing, or other on-site accommodations until full payment has been received.
- If a participant applies and is accepted to a program after the stated payment deadlines, full payment will be due upon acceptance into the program, and all standard cancellation and refund policies apply.
- Participants must submit all program deposits and payments according to the financial deadlines determined by BridgeAbroad. Failure to do so may jeopardize participation on the program. Returned checks and declined credit card payments will be deemed as non-payment. BridgeAbroad assumes no liability if payment is declined by a participant’s credit card provider and will not disclose to a participant the reasons for the denial. The participant should contact his or her credit card provider for this information. A handling fee of $25 will be assessed on any check returned by the bank.
- If payment is not submitted by the stated deadlines, a non-refundable $195 late fee will be charged. This fee must be paid immediately, along with the remainder of the program fees due, in order to participate in the program.
- BridgeAbroad accepts the following payment methods: credit card, check, PayPal, and wire transfer. The data that you provide during this transaction will only be used for the purpose of recording your payment. BridgeAbroad will abide by applicable data protection laws and regulations, ensure that the data is used for no other purpose, and is not disclosed to any third party unless there is a legal obligation for that disclosure. For more information, please refer to the BridgeAbroad Privacy Policy.
- BridgeAbroad will withhold final grades for any participant with an outstanding balance due to BridgeAbroad, including amounts incurred on-site by, or on behalf of, the participant. The participant will be billed for all amounts due and owing to BridgeAbroad, which must be paid in full before grades will be released. Unpaid balances not paid within thirty (30) days of invoice will be subject to late fees of 1.5% per month.
Cancellation & Refund Policies
- All program cancellations and refund requests must be made in writing to BridgeAbroad (by email, fax, or mail). Phone calls will not be accepted. The date of receipt of the refund request will determine the refund amount payable to the withdrawing participant. If a participant does not notify BridgeAbroad about her/his withdrawal in writing, and does not arrive on-site on the scheduled program arrival date, no refunds will be issued.
- BridgeAbroad reserves the right to change or cancel a program at any time. Although BridgeAbroad endeavors to run each of its programs as scheduled, in the event that BridgeAbroad cancels a program prior to commencement of the program (excluding instances of Force Majeure), participants will receive a full refund of all fees and deposits, minus the application fee.
- In an event of Force Majeure, considered as all events beyond the control of BridgeAbroad, including, but not limited to natural or industrial disasters, acts of terror, war, civil disorder, government restrictions and/or any other cause which BridgeAbroad cannot prevent or foresee, the following refund policies apply:
- If such event occurs prior to the commencement of the program and results in cancellation of the program, BridgeAbroad will provide full refund to participants, less any program costs and third-party fees already incurred;
- If such event occurs after the commencement of the program, no refunds will be issued and BridgeAbroad will not be liable for any losses or damages. All participants are encouraged to have travel cancellation insurance to cover any such eventualities.
- All refunds will be issued back to the original form of payment within 6-8 weeks of notification of cancellation. BridgeAbroad undertakes no liability if this refund period is exceeded. If payment was made by a third-party (such as a parent or home university) on behalf of a participant, the refund will be issued to the third-party.
- No refund will be issued if the participant is dismissed from the program as a result of a violation of BridgeAbroad’s Code of Conduct or violation of law, including, but not limited to a violation resulting in deportation. Any expenses incurred by BridgeAbroad in dismissing a participant from the program for such violations will be the responsibility of the participant.
- No housing refunds will be granted if participants are removed from housing due to failure to abide by housing regulations. Participants will be responsible for paying for any damages made to the accommodations during their stay, which may reduce any or all deposit refunds and result in additional fees being owed to BridgeAbroad if the deposit is not sufficient to cover the cost of the damages. If damages occur in a shared room, all occupants will jointly and severally share financial responsibility.
- If a participant fails to submit required paperwork by the assigned deadlines and/or does not respond to BridgeAbroad communications, s/he may be considered withdrawn from the program and not eligible for a refund.
- If a participant does not fully take part in any included BridgeAbroad program activities, no refunds will be issued for the unused services.
- Participants who do not obtain the necessary passport or visa documents required, are unable to secure their desired courses or have difficulty transferring academic credit will not be subject to any special refund; the standard BridgeAbroad Cancellation Policy will apply.
- If you cancel your program after having already completed one or more BridgeVirtual language sessions, you will be subject to a cancellation fee equaling the retail price of the BridgeVirtual lessons taken in addition to the standard Cancellation & Refund policies described in this document.
- If a participant wishes to defer his or her participation on a BridgeAbroad program, s/he may only do so once. There will be no fee if the deferral or change is requested at least sixty-one (61) days prior to the scheduled program arrival date. A non-refundable $195 fee will be applied to participants who defer or change their program between sixty (60) and thirty-one (31) days prior to the scheduled program arrival date, and all standard cancellation policies apply. No deferrals or changes are allowed less than thirty-one (31) days prior to the scheduled program arrival date.
- For participants who withdraw from the program:
- 61 or more days prior to the scheduled program arrival date (as stated on the BridgeAbroad website), the participant will be refunded the full program fee, less non-refundable fees including the application fee and confirmation deposit;
- 60 days to 31 days prior to the scheduled program arrival date, the participant will be refunded 50% of the program fee, less non-refundable fees including the application fee and confirmation deposit;
- 30 days or less prior to the scheduled program arrival date, the participant will receive no refunds.
- Participants are responsible for program fees according to the schedule above. Should a participant withdraw within the timeframe listed above, having not paid the due amount of the program fee, s/he will be invoiced for the portion due and held responsible for paying that amount. If a participant fails to comply with this agreement, legal action may be taken.
- Refunds and cancellation fees are determined based on the date when the written cancellation notice is received from the participant. Please note that participants may also be responsible for additional cancellation penalties and fees at their home institution.
